R005V Remote control manual Warning Do not expose the remote control to damp air. Do not throw the remote control from high altitude. Be careful not to let children and pets touch the remote control. This remote control uses a scrolling code. Please use the remote control code according to the operating instructions of the external wireless receiving device. The control of the remote control is achieved by briefly pressing the corresponding button. LED indicator light: Press the button to light up the indicator light, and it will turn off within 3 seconds after being released; When the battery level is low, press the button to dim the LED brightness, and at the same time, the remote control distance becomes closer; Stop working when the battery level is below 2.3V. During the disposal process, current normative documents formulated by local legislative bodies should be followed. Technical Parameter Working Mode:OOK Operating Frequency:433.94MHz Radiation Intensity:Not exceeding 2mW Remote Control Distance(20±5)°С:Open environment greater than 80 meters Battery Model:CR2032 Working Voltage:3V Ambient Temperature:-20°С ~ +50°С Size:65x33x14mm FCC Statement Changes or modifications not expressly approved by the party responsible for compliance could void the user's authority to operate the equipment. Radio frequency radiation exposure evaluation: portable devices 1.1 Radio Frequency Exposure Compliance 1.1.1 Electromagnetic Fields RESULT: Pass Test Specification Test item : 5 BUTTONS TREK FOB Identification / Type No. : R005V FCC ID : 2BDX6-R005V Test standard : CFR47 FCC Part 2: Section 2.1093 FCC KDB Publication 447498 v06 Measurement Record: EIRP[dBm] = E[dBuV/m] − 95.2 =72.36 – 95.2 =-22.84 dBm Since maximum peak output power of the transmitter is -22.84 dBm ≈0.005mW < 22mW. Hence the EUT is excluded from SAR evaluation according to FCC KDB Publication 447498 D01 General RF Exposure Guidance v06.
